Drag and then drop files between a Citrix session and a local endpoint

Description

Citrix now supports Dragging and then dropping files between a Citrix session and a local endpoint.

You can drag and then drop files, groups of files, directories, groups of directories, or a combination of files and directories to and from the same client on the session.  This ability applies to a desktop session or a seamless app. This includes the desktop, Explorer window, and some applications. 
 


Instructions

  • On CVAD 2003, To enable drag-and-drop, make the following registry setting on the host: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\CtxDNDSvc\
Name: Enabled
Type: REG_DWORD
Value: 1

  • After you enable the registry value, and if using the required Citrix Workspace app version, drag-and-drop is enabled after the next session logon.

 

  • From CVAD 2012, we have a new policy ‘Drag and Drop’ in the Studio to accomplish the same task. This feature is enabled by default.
  • Note:- “From CVAD 2109, Drag and Drop policy is set to 'disabled' as default”

Additional Information

Limitation:
  • You cannot drag a file from a client desktop into a Firefox or Internet Explorer browser window inside a desktop session.
  • You cannot drag and then drop into a zipped folder, into an application shortcut, a message from a seamless application to a client desktop, or into a seamless Outlook message if dragged quickly from a client.
Minimum requirement:
  • The feature requires a minimum of Citrix Workspace app 2002 for Windows.
  • CVAD 2003 and above.

Note: Starting CVAD 2012 the registry setting will not enable Drag and drop. You must use the 2012+ Drag and drop policy to enable drag and drop in CVAD 2012 and new VDAs
